A screw jack actuator is a mechanical device that converts rotary motion into linear motion. It consists of a screw mechanism that rotates and moves a load vertically or horizontally depending on the application. The actuator is driven by a motor or hand crank that turns the screw, causing the load to move up or down along the threads of the screw.
One of the key benefits of screw jack actuators is their ability to lift heavy loads with precision and control. The screw mechanism provides a mechanical advantage that allows for the lifting of loads that would be impossible to move manually. This makes screw jack actuators ideal for applications such as raising platforms, adjusting the height of machinery, or lifting heavy equipment in manufacturing plants.
